1. Commercial Street
Also known as Sarojini Market Bangalore, this is one of the biggest street shopping destinations in Bangalore where you will find everything starting from clothes, jewelry, home décor items, shoes, trinkets, and accessories at the most budget-friendly rates. Apart from that, you can also buy antiques from here at some lucrative rates. Another best thing about this market is that here an entire lane is dedicated to shoes while another is dedicated to silver jewelry. When you are in Commercial Street, if you get tired, then visit the food stalls and enjoy the Sulaiman Chai or a delectable plate of biriyani.

3. Brigade Road
Situated between Residency Road and MG Road, and 3km away from the City Market, this is another popular shopping street in Bangalore known for both famous brand outlets and street-side shops. Here you can find different types of trendy clothes and accessories at pocket-friendly rates. So, you can walk through the footpaths to explore different branded showrooms selling electronic goods, garments, footwear, jewelry, etc. Besides, some shops sell non-branded dresses at affordable rates. Another attraction of this place is Blossom’s Book House, one of the oldest bookshops in Silicon Valley.

5. UB City Mall
If you are looking for luxury places to visit in Bangalore for shopping, this is one of the most popular ones. Launched in 2008, it is the first luxury mall in India that houses several branded stores including Burberry, Louis Vuitton, Canali, Rolex, etc. Being the classic example of class and excellence, this mall showcases around forty globally acclaimed brands that are hard to find in any other mall.

7. Chickpet Market
This is one of the oldest shopping destinations in Bangalore where you can find traditional fabric and silk sarees of every design, quality, and price range. One of the most interesting parts of this market is that the entire lane bursts with numerous street shops that make it fun to shop. Being a wholesale market, here you will find traditional clothing like dress materials at budget-friendly rates. Other things that you will find in this market are jewelry, footwear, and accessories. Apart from that, this place also offers conventional wooden musical instruments of different niches. Last but not least, people also visit this market to get the best deals on precious metals like silver and gold and jewelry made of these metals.

8. Residency Road
When you look for the best street shopping in Bangalore, this is one of the names you can count on. People often visit this market to shop for traditional arts and crafts, handcrafted wooden artifacts, sandalwood soaps, and ethnic wear. Located in the heart of Bangalore, this market is also highly preferred by people, who look for souvenirs. Other things you can find here are beautiful brassware and jewelry items. Apart from being a hub of Karnataka handicrafts, here you will also find handicraft items from Tamil Nadu, Gujarat, and Odisha.
